  "textContent": "Monolith’s debut release Esoterika opens with “Formless” before moving into “Khronos”, two tracks that establish a distinct electronic world built around atmosphere, texture, and gradual development. “Formless” begins in dark territory, introducing low-frequency synth tones, distant electronic noises, and slowly evolving textures.
